Your Opportunity

The role of Project Manager is to work both independently and as a team member on projects of various size and complexity. This is a fantastic opportunity to be a part of a strong and collaborative team of industry leading professionals. The selected candidate will be responsible for project delivery, financials, construction oversight in combination with our Field Services group, proposals, and client success. The projects that a Project Manager may be assigned to may have complex features that will require the application of mature knowledge. This role also leads the analysis of proposed community development projects to ensure timely project delivery, resource efficiency, and cost-effectiveness.

The Stantec Alberta South Community Development group provides services to land developers in the Calgary and Southern Alberta. This individual will be responsible for managing the relationships with some of our most valued developer clients, providing exceptional customer service.

Your Key Responsibilities

  • Lead and be responsible for the preparation of Subdivision Engineering drawings (residential, industrial and commercial). This may include technical review and professional stamping of engineering design drawings. It also includes the preparation of construction specifications and tender documents. Stamping capabilities are preferred but not required if the individual exhibits exceptional land development project management experience.

  • Provide internal peer review of designs by other land development engineers/technologists.

  • Guide projects through to completion including preliminary/conceptual design, detailed design, scheduling, tendering and construction.

  • Coordinate designs with stormwater management engineers and incorporate stormwater designs into land development drawings.

  • Provide high-level engineering input to Area Structure Plans, Outline Plans and Land Reviews.

  • Liaise with clients, agencies and others to obtain and determine project requirements, permits, and approvals.

  • Ensure that client needs are met in a timely and cost-effective manner.

  • Ensure projects meet applicable specifications and standards as per the governing municipality and adhere to Stantec’s QA/QC program.

  • Coordinate work of junior land development staff and review their deliverables.

  • Be the main client contact on the project(s).

  • Be responsible for each project schedule, budget and reporting.

  • Participate in expanding our client and project portfolio through proposals and business development opportunities

  • Be supported through industry volunteer opportunities (examples could include BILD, ULI, NAIOP, CREW, etc.)

Your Capabilities and Credentials

  • Must have a thorough understanding of land development. (including site grading, sanitary and storm sewer servicing, water servicing, shallow utility coordination, road and parking design)

  • Must be a self-motivated individual possessing strong written and verbal communication skills.

  • Must exhibit attention to detail and accuracy.

  • Must be able to coordinate engineering requirements with planning and landscape architecture requirements.

  • Must work well in a team environment and have a collaborative approach.

  • A working knowledge of AutoCAD Civil 3D is an asset.

Education and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ree in civil engineering and registered as a Professional Engineer with APEGA is preferred but not required.

  • Experience in the City of Calgary and surrounding area is preferred.

  • A minimum of 10 years of related land development experience is preferred.
